Developmental delay refers to a slowdown or abnormal sequence in the growth and development process. The incidence rate is between 6% and 8%. Children can develop normally under normal internal and external environment. Any factors that are not conducive to children's growth and development can affect their development to varying degrees, thus causing children's growth retardation.

To be specific, developmentally delayed children refer to children who are under the age of 18 and have developmental delays or abnormalities in cognition, development, physiological development, language, any communication development, psychosocial development, or self-care hopes due to various diseases or non-disease factors (including cranial nerve or muscular nerve physiological diseases, psychological diseases, social environmental factors, etc.).

Human growth and development refers to the process of maturation from fertilized egg to adult. Growth and development are important characteristics that distinguish children from adults. Growth refers to the growth of various organs and systems in a child's body, and corresponding measurements can be used to represent the changes in their quantity; development refers to the differentiation and functional maturation of cells, tissues, and organs. Growth and development are closely related. Growth is the material basis of development. Changes in the amount of growth can reflect the maturity of the body's organs and systems to a certain extent.
